Marino Eager To Break Milan Record

Marino knows that AC Milan regard the Stadio Friuli as a happy hunting ground, having not lost there in four seasons. As such, he's keen to turn it around.

Speaking to the media before the game, the manager remarked, "We have prepared for this match by looking into every detail.

"Milan's squad comprises tremendous players who can change the game at any time. We need to keep our balance and prevent them from having space.

"They're a different team compared to the one of two months ago - that Club World Cup win helped them. And last Sunday [5-2 win over Napoli], Ancelotti's boys showed what they're really capable of."

However, there is some succour for Marino: Andrea Pirlo will miss out for the visitors.

"Pirlo's a key player for Milan in that he dictates the rhythm of their play, but they have a star-studded squad with alternatives in it," he mused.

"No one player will settle this match - instead, overall tactics will do so.

"We'll do all we can to remain among the top four. We haven't changed our objectives and will take it one game at a time. A club like Udinese can't lose its concentration or go down the wrong path even for a moment."
